This table shows which chapter in CHOW (Child's History of the World by Hillyer) correlates to which chapter in SOTW (Story of the World by Susan Wise Bauer). The first digit in the SOTW chapter represents which book (SOTW-1 or SOTW-2). The number after the hyphen is the chapter number. Be forewarned, this list is an inexact correlation at best. Many times a single chapter in one book correlates to more than one chapter in the other. When the chapters don't match, you decide what you want to use.
The last column matches SOTW chapters with chapters from the Child's Story Bible by Catherine Vos. Thank you, Tina Duke, for compiling the Vos correlation.
I do not expect to add SOTW-3 to this table. The two books no longer correlate very well. CHOW takes only 11 chapters to cover 1600 to 1850, while SOTW devotes 42 chapters to the same period.
